The Rozvi Empire (1480–1866) was a Shona state established on the Zimbabwean Plateau by Changamire Dombo.The term "Rozvi" refers to their legacy as a warrior nation, taken from the Shona term kurozva, "to plunder".
Following the meeting of Commonwealth heads of government held in Lusaka from 1–7 August 1979, [5] [6] the British government invited bishop Abel Muzorewa, the recently installed prime minister of the (unrecognized) Zimbabwe Rhodesia government, along with the leaders of the Patriotic Front (the name of the ZANU-ZAPU coalition), to participate in a constitutional conference at Lancaster House.
